Transaction 68318226d5d6221bca8c7d7a62361e43bd3f555f87e01e0191ed2325a68640c6
1 Input
1 Output
-
68318226d5d6221bca8c7d7a62361e43bd3f555f87e01e0191ed2325a68640c6:0
- value
- 126093
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c600abc14d433ea0f6fe5ef48f4221fcd67d48f OP_EQUAL
- address
- 32pT5xQoiNLT4BjPBX7xWMfEpVjuLSpQ4x